Transaction e69c125ab7035f566bd95815d525b4375bc4d1c739f7a504f5de43c057096767
1 Input
1 Output
-
e69c125ab7035f566bd95815d525b4375bc4d1c739f7a504f5de43c057096767:0
- value
- 23296
- script pubkey
- OP_0 OP_PUSHBYTES_20 5b04738bf24c6bb545ed11ec495caf3a00b37f9a
- address
- bc1qtvz88zljf34m230dz8kyjh908gqtxlu6zaqxzk